Job Title: Cloud Cybersecurity Specialist

Location of role: Skokie , IL 60076 - Currently remote within the Chicagoland area no more than 2 hours distance from Skokie IL of major highways - Must be able to come onsite possibly once a month.

Must be vaccinated.

Salary or Hourly range: $150K to 160K Depending on experience DOE

Key Points of the role:

Cloud Cybersecurity Specialist
  • Education: A Bachelor's degree is required.
  • Minimum six years of experience across Information Technology, Cloud Services, and Security is required.
  • Professional-level advanced technical or security certification required. Azure-specific cloud engineer certification preferred.
  • Working knowledge of programming languages such as Java, C#, .Net, Python, SQL or similar.
  • Experience building and maintaining infrastructure as code with frameworks like Terraform, CloudFormation, CDK, etc.
  • Advanced understanding of incident management and vulnerability remediation with excellent technical investigation and problem solving skills.
  • Familiarity with cybersecurity industry standard frameworks such as NIST CSF, ISO, and CSA.
  • Knowledge of healthcare applications, trends and industry standards a plus.

What you will do:

  • Lead Cybersecurity Team initiatives to define and build reliable, scalable, and secure architecture using Microsoft Azure cloud technologies and services.
  • Make recommendations to stand-up and configure security in a variety of Azure technologies and services
  • Navigate best practice, regulatory, and industry practices and requirements
  • Use automation to implement and manage secure enterprise solutions using well-designed, testable, and efficient code.
  • Participate in technical solution and design discussions as the security subject matter expert.
  • Guide the design, development, management, support and maintenance of Microsoft's Cloud Access Security Broker (CASB), Data Loss Prevention (DLP), and Azure Active Directory/Azure Identity services.
  • Investigate security incidents and perform compliance reviews.
  • Provide second and third-level support and analysis during and after a security incident.
  • Implement technical measures or leverage existing technologies to prevent sensitive data from leaving the organization.
  • Serve as a liaison between business users, application owners, software vendors, and project managers to ensure security requirements are understood and interpreted correctly.
  • Assist with all phases of project instantiation, including requirements gathering, evaluation, design, build, test, workflow analysis/optimization and support.
  • Create technical, project management, operational, training, testing, and other documentation as required.
  • Contribute to the development and maintenance of security policies, procedures, and standards, incorporating cloud technologies and DevOps/SecOps concepts as appropriate.
  • Conduct cloud security business impact analyses.
  • Provide status report/update on assigned projects and tasks as requested by management.
  • Participate in and/or lead appropriate user forum, planning session, status meeting, and department meetings to provide a Health Information Technology perspective on pending activities and strategic initiatives.
  • Foster a security culture within the team and share security best practices with technical and application team colleagues.
